Block 670,784

Block Hash

5ec49cf38c032165d30453724a078898b20210fa54ac7c7d7d57b8752f70f91f

Previous Block Hash

0ad61f4708fe72d1b2b8140b09df54290f2067e0a8e9c94b03b6b8a811ad1ae6

Mined

Transactions

3

Difficulty

51.58 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.01226 PEPE
1 input, 2 outputs
70,295.01586 PEPE
1 input, 2 outputs
291.87657 PEPE